Sen. Tom Cotton says Republicans are ‘open’ to Trump’s IVF plan but need to assess fiscal impact

Sen. Tom Cotton, R-Ark., said Sunday he and most other Republicans would be “open” to supporting former President Donald Trump’s proposal to have either the government or insurance companies pay for in vitro fertilization services.
